SPX opened at 6,056.97 and closed at 6,038.10, down 0.31% on the session (range 6,013.18–6,060.86). The close sat 25.7 points above the zero-gamma flip at 6,012.4 — dealer hedging in vol-dampening territory. Call resistance 6,040, put support 6,100. 0DTE ATM IV opened at 11.5%.

Price crossed the flip 7 times, first at 09:31 ET. The tape spent 24% of the day above VWAP. The expected-hold band 6,012.4–6,112.5 contained the entire session.
